I have run the AlphaTest, which for me does not display anything.  Are there additonal test for the various behaviors??

I cannot tell you too much abour behaviors in general. But if you only want to rotate a group around an axis, you should have a look at org.xith3d.behaviors.impl.RotatableGroup and (more general) org.xith3d.behaviors.Animatable. They can be perfectly used with ExtRenderLoop. org.xith3d.test.amination.* demostrate the usage.
